Luckily there’s a new space in Houston, Texas, built just for that, provided by Cryptospaces, which is backed by bitcoin consulting company, FinalHash. Located at 6907 Almeda Rd., the Houston Bitcoin Embassy is an incubator/ coworking space dedicated to tech startups. There are also plans to install a bitcoin ATM in the facility by the end of April. The Embassy is home to the Texas Coinitiative, a non-profit organization that promotes the use of Bitcoin in Texas. CryptoCoins News,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ST DevCore is a new initiative undertaken by the Bitcoin Foundation to increase funds for supporting grants and development. The DevCore events are run over a full day and also serve to provide networking experiences and educating current and potential developers about core principles involved with block chain technology.
